What is thalamus. Explain its functions in brief

An area which coordinates the sensory impulses receiving from the various sense organs including eyes, ears, skin, etc. and then transmits it to the cerebrum. Thalamus is found in the limbic system within the cerebrum. This limbic system is mainly responsible for the formation of new memories and storing past experiences.
